What is BPC-157 ARG?
BPC-157 ARG is a modified version of the well-researched peptide BPC-157, consisting of 15 amino acids with the addition of arginine. This modification is designed to enhance the stability and bioavailability of the compound, making it a valuable tool for researchers studying tissue repair, inflammation, and wound healing in controlled laboratory settings. How Does BPC-157 ARG Work?
Research suggests that BPC157 ARG may work through several biological mechanisms in preclinical models:
Researchers have observed that BPC-157 ARG may boost collagen synthesis, which could improve wound healing and tissue strength. The compound also appears to inhibit inflammatory pathways, potentially reducing swelling and supporting faster recovery from injuries. Additionally, BPC157 ARG may offer cellular protection against damage, supporting overall tissue health and regeneration. Studies further suggest it may promote angiogenesis, the development of new blood vessels, which plays a critical role in injury recovery and tissue healing.

Current State of BPC157 ARG Research
Research on BPC-157 ARG is actively ongoing. Preliminary studies have shown promising results in areas such as inflammation reduction, joint function improvement, pain management, and tissue repair. However, further scientific investigation is required to fully understand the long-term safety and effectiveness of this compound. All findings should be interpreted within the context of early stage research.
